for the arithmetic sequence 42, 32, 22, 12... find the 18th term.

Answers

Answer:

The18th term of the given sequence is -128

Explanation:

To find the 18th term of the sequence:

42, 32, 22, 12, ..., we need to find the nth term of the sequence first.

The nth term of a sequence is given be the formula:

[tex]T_n=a+(n-1)d[/tex]

Where a is the first term, and d is the common difference.

Here, a = 42, d = 32 - 42 = -10

[tex]\begin{gathered} T_n=42+(n-1)(-10) \\ =42-10n+10 \\ T_n=52-10n \end{gathered}[/tex]

To find the 18th terem, substitute n = 18 into the nth term

[tex]\begin{gathered} T_{18}=52-10(18) \\ =52-180 \\ =-128 \end{gathered}[/tex]

Write the equation of the horizontal line that goes through the point (9, 6).

Answers

Given the point:

(x, y) ==. (9, 6)

Let's write the equation of the horizontal line that goes through the given point.

On a horizonal line, every point on the line has the same value of y.

The slope of a horizontal line is 0.

Since every point on a horizontal line has the same value of y, to find the equation of a horizontal line, we are to use the y-coordinate of the point to find the equation of the horizontal line.

We have:

y-coordinate of the point = 6

Hence, the equation of the horizontal line that goes through the point is:

y = 6

ANSWER:

y = 6

An experiment consists of drawing 1 card from a standard 52-card deck. What is the probability of drawing a queen ? Question content area bottomPart 1The probability of drawing a queen is   enter your response here .(Type an integer or a simplified fraction.)

Answers

Given:

Total number of cards = 52

Number of cards drawn = 1

Then:

Number of ways of drawing a card from 52 cards

[tex]\begin{gathered} =^{52}C_1 \\ =52 \end{gathered}[/tex]

Number of queens in a deck of cards = 4

Number of ways that one card is a queen

[tex]\begin{gathered} =^4C_1 \\ =4 \end{gathered}[/tex]

Probability of drawing a queen

[tex]\begin{gathered} =\frac{\text{ Number of favorable cases}}{\text{ Total number of cases}} \\ =\frac{4}{52} \\ =\frac{1}{13} \end{gathered}[/tex]

Final answer: 1/13
